Product Information

3-(Aminomethyl)pyridine is a versatile chemical compound recognized for its significant role in various industrial and research applications. This compound, also known as 3-pyridinemethanamine, is characterized by its amine functional group, which enhances its reactivity and makes it a valuable intermediate in the synthesis of p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, and specialty chemicals. Its unique structure allows it to participate in a range of chemical reactions, including nucleophilic substitutions and condensation reactions, making it an essential building block in the development of more complex molecules.

In the pharmaceutical industry, 3-(Aminomethyl)pyridine is utilized in the synthesis of various bioactive compounds, contributing to the development of new therapeutic agents. Additionally, its application in the production of agrochemicals highlights its importance in enhancing crop protection and yield. Researchers appreciate its ability to facilitate the creation of novel compounds, making it a key player in medicinal chemistry and material science. Applications

3-(Aminomethyl)pyridine is widely utilized in research focused on:

  • Pharmaceutical Development: This compound serves as a key intermediate in the synthesis of various pharmaceuticals, particularly in the development of drugs targeting neurological disorders.
  • Catalysis: It is employed as a ligand in catalytic processes, enhancing reaction efficiency in organic synthesis, which is crucial for the production of fine chemicals.
  • Material Science: The compound is used in the formulation of advanced materials, such as polymers and coatings, due to its ability to improve adhesion and durability.
  • Agricultural Chemicals: It plays a role in the development of agrochemicals, contributing to the formulation of effective pesticides and herbicides that are safer for the environment.
  • Analytical Chemistry: This chemical is utilized in analytical methods for detecting and quantifying various substances, providing reliable results in quality control processes.
